
做自己的英雄为您分享以下优质知识
n个二进制代码可以表示的状态数量可以通过以下方式计算:
基本原理
每个二进制位有2种可能的状态(0或1)。因此,n个二进制位可以组合出 $2^n$ 种不同的状态。这种计算方式类似于十进制中n位数的组合数(10^n种可能)。
示例说明
- 1位:2种状态(0或1)
- 2位:4种状态(00, 01, 10, 11)
- 3位:8种状态(000-111)
- 8位:256种状态(00000000-11111111)
应用场景
二进制编码广泛应用于计算机领域,例如:
- 1字节(8位)可表示256种状态,常用于字符编码(如ASCII码);
- 2字节(16位)可表示65536种状态,适用于更复杂的符号表示。
扩展说明
二进制的这种特性使其成为计算机硬件(如逻辑电路)和软件(如数据存储)的基础,简化了信息的表示与处理。
综上,n个二进制代码可以表示 $2^n$ 种不同状态,这一结论在计算机科学中具有基础性和广泛的应用价值。